Cross tees are an essential element of suspended ceiling systems. They offer structural support, design flexibility, and access to crucial utilities, making them invaluable in both residential and commercial applications. Understanding the role and installation of cross tees can help ensure a successful ceiling project, contributing to the overall functionality and aesthetic appeal of a space. Whether for sound control, maintenance access, or visual design, cross tees enhance the performance and utility of suspended ceilings in countless ways.

A fire rated access panel is a specialized type of panel that provides easy access to essential building components, like plumbing, electrical systems, or HVAC units, all while maintaining fire-resistance capabilities. The 2x2 designation refers to its dimensions—2 feet by 2 feet—which makes it a popular choice for both commercial and residential applications.
